Overview
Circle the Emerald Isle on this 8-day Sri Lanka tour from Colombo to Kandy, up into the tea country of Nuwara Eliya, down to the golden coast at Bentota and back to the capital. With breakfast, lunch and dinner all included, this is touring at its most comfortable.
Meet gentle giants at the Pinnawala Elephant Orphanage, stand before the sacred Temple of the Tooth Relic, pause at the Ramboda Waterfall and walk gardens steeped in Ramayana legend at Hakgala. The coast brings the Kosgoda Turtle Conservation project and a boat ride on the Madu River before Colombo's forts, Cinnamon Gardens and Galle Face Green wrap up the journey.
